Also, as much as those national charity organizations garner donations, not much of that is seen by women that have been diagnosed with the many forms of breast cancer.  If you want to really make a difference in a womans life within your community, here is a list of ideas to help out.

 

1. Donate time and groceries making precooked meals that can either be microwaved or thrown directly in the oven.  The last thing a woman is able to do after a mastectomy or chemo treatment is cook a healthy meal. These are by far the most appreciated items that can be directly donated.

 

2. October is breast cancer month but its also time to winterize.  A great way to help out is organize a few handymen and women to help with a few seasonal chores for a woman that has been recently diagnosed.  Rake leaves, clean out gutters, stack some firewood.  Clean a chimney or have a service do it. Go through and check for drafts around windows.  Caulking is cheap enough but the labor can get costly.  Helping a woman with these tasks is another way to show your appreciation.  This is also a good way to get the local high school football/basketball or FFA involved in community projects.

 

3. Women that are handy with knitting can make beanie caps to help keep cancer patients from being exposed to the elements.  These can be made in bulk and either donated to a local cancer charity or directly to an oncology group.  Trust me these are priceless.

 

4. We call them sunshine boxes.  This includes a nice felt throw, chapstick, lemon gumdrop candies, books, and water in small bottles in either a canvas bag or nice reusable box.  These can be donated to women going through chemotherapy.  There are other items but i cant think of them at the moment.

 

5. This is a big one and only costs you a bit of time.  Take her out to coffee or bring coffee and a listening ear.  A lot of women going through many types of cancer treatment get lost in doctors appointments and surgeries.  They forget to have girl time.  A woman who is just there to listen is invaluable.  You would be surprised at how isolated some women get. They most likely cant work, they cant make it through a shopping trip and are relegated to staying away from public places, so having someone stop by just for a visit is a lovely thing. 

 

And remember, 1 in 8 women will be diagnosed with some type of breast cancer in their lifetimes. Donate Local, help your community first.
